Ask a younger user where they discover a new restaurant, fashion trend, travel destination, or skincare routine, and many won’t mention a traditional search engine first. Instead, they’ll open Instagram or TikTok, type a question into the search bar, and scroll through short videos, creator posts, comments, and hashtags until they find an answer they trust.
For marketers, this behavior represents a major shift. Social platforms are no longer just places to publish content—they’re becoming discovery engines. Brands that still optimize only for traditional search risk missing audiences who now begin their buying journey inside social apps. This is where social media optimization becomes a critical part of a modern digital strategy.

Captions Have Become Search Assets
Captions now serve a larger purpose than adding context.
Well-written captions help platforms understand:
- Topic relevance
- User intent
- Location
- Industry
- Product category
Natural keyword placement often performs better than excessive hashtag use.
As AI social media search continues improving, descriptive captions become even more valuable because AI relies heavily on contextual signals.

Comments Influence Discoverability
Many marketers overlook comments.
Yet comment sections often contain additional keywords, follow-up questions, and user experiences that strengthen topical relevance.
Encouraging meaningful discussion helps platforms better understand what a post actually covers.
Comments also provide valuable content ideas because they reveal the exact language audiences use when searching.
Search Intent Changes Across Platforms
Although Instagram and TikTok appear similar, user expectations differ.
Instagram users often search for:
- Inspiration
- Lifestyle content
- Local businesses
- Visual portfolios
TikTok users frequently look for:
- Tutorials
- Reviews
- Honest opinions
- Product comparisons
- Quick education
Recognizing these differences improves social media optimization by matching content style to user intent.
AI Is Reshaping Social Discovery
Recommendation systems now predict what users want before they finish searching.
Signals include:
- Watch time
- Saves
- Shares
- Replays
- Comments
- Viewing history
These behavioral indicators power AI social media search, helping platforms deliver increasingly relevant content instead of relying only on typed keywords.
For marketers, engagement quality is becoming more important than follower count.

Metrics That Matter
Follower growth alone provides limited insight.
Track metrics such as:
- Search impressions
- Saves
- Shares
- Average watch time
- Profile visits
- Website clicks
- Conversion rate
These indicators better reflect whether your content is being discovered through search rather than passive browsing.
